Introduction

Adds two pages of information showing real-time bandwidth use. When used as a (part of a) startup script one or more small packages are downloaded into WRT's /tmp.

This is a great bandwidth logging app that runs on the WRT54G. The latest version will backup to ftp or jffs and will restore automatically after a reboot etc. Very good for people with limited bandwidth per billing period.

Prerequisites

You should already have:
-a Linksys WRT54G product
-DD-WRT installed as the firmware
